Keith Haring 1986 collotype print from “Fault Lines”, edition of 200. Numbered lower left 39/200. Printed by Edition Schellmann & Kluser Munich. From a scarce collection of erotic stories with collotype illustrations by Keith Haring and texts by Brion Gysin.

"In 1985, Keith had made a series of drawings for a text by Brion Gysin and wanted to turn this material into a book. However, he did not succeed in finding a publisher due to the heavy sexual imagery in his drawings. So he asked me if I could recommend a publisher in Germany. When I looked at the drawings, I could see the problem, but spontaneously offered to publish the book myself if Keith were to do an object in an edition for me - assuming that the book would hardly pay for its printing costs. Keith was very pleased and promised to come up with something – which indeed he did: he made the Dog multiple. As expected, the book sold slowly over the years, whereas the Dog garnered great popularity over the 30 years of its existence." – Jörg Schellmann
